Adaptive Impedance Matching Module for Military and Public Safety
Antenna and Power Amplifier Applications
Next-Generation ParaTune™ Passive
Tunable ICs Yield New Applications
COLUMBIA, Md. (Business Wire EON) April 23, 2008 --
Paratek Microwave, Inc., a technology leader in radio frequency (RF)
components for wireless applications, is now shipping high-performance Adaptive
Impedance Matching Module (AIMM™)
evaluation kits that have been optimized for Military and Public Safety
radio applications. Based on Paratek’s ParaScanTM
tunable RF technology,
AIMM is currently finding widespread application in commercial cellular
handsets. The 7mm x 21mm AIMM unit dynamically adjusts its internal
impedance matching circuit to minimize reflected power, thereby
achieving a near-optimal match. The most common application for AIMM is
correcting antenna and amplifier mismatch conditions that often occur
with handheld radios and body-worn antennas. AIMM can handle in excess
of 2 watts with extremely low intermodulation distortion thanks to
Paratek’s ParaTuneTM
family of Passive
Tunable ICs (PTICs). This technology makes AIMM feasible by
overcoming the power limitations of other tunable technologies such as
varactor diodes and MEMS.
AIMM systems for handheld radios have yielded improvements in total
radiated power in excess of 5 dB by correcting the antenna mismatch that
occurs when a radio is in close proximity to the user’s
head or torso. AIMM can also be applied in sensor networks where the
sensor’s antenna can be detuned by proximity
effects of the ground, foliage, or debris.
While the primary application of AIMM is for antenna or power amplifier
tuning, the product can be used for any application that requires
forward power to be maximized and reverse power to be minimized.
AIMM is a self-contained multi-chip-module (MCM) comprising a tunable
impedance network incorporating Paratek’s
PTICs, an on-board microprocessor with custom control algorithms,
forward and reverse power detectors, and a bias voltage generator. AIMM’s
adaptation and sleep modes are controlled via an SPI interface. The
evaluation kit consists of an AIMM mounted on a test fixture with SMA RF
connectors as well as an external mechanical switch box that allows
standalone operation of the module. While the modules have been
optimized for constant amplitude modulation such as FM or BPSK,
specialized software loads are available for other modulation types.
Paratek is now shipping AIMM kits operating over 280 - 300 MHz, 824 -
960 MHz, and 1710 - 1980 MHz. Standard kits are priced at $3,000 and
ship approximately four weeks after receipt of order. Other bands within
the frequency range of 200 MHz to 2.2 GHz are available for a nominal
NRE charge.
